This directory contains various Python modules used to support servo development.

servo

servo-specific python code e.g. implementations of mach commands. This is the canonical repository for this code.

tidy

servo-tidy is used to check licenses, line lengths, whitespace, flake8 on Python files, lock file versions, and more.

wpt

servo-wpt is a module with support scripts for running, importing, exporting, updating manifests, and updating expectations for WPT tests.
